Skip to content

Commit 02c09ec

Browse files
Update OpenAPI Description (#56387)
Co-authored-by: Sam Browning <106113886+sabrowning1@users.noreply.github.com>
1 parent b63d9f0 commit 02c09ec

28 files changed

+2007
-490
lines changed
Lines changed: 13 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,13 @@
1+
---
2+
title: REST API endpoints for {% data variables.product.prodname_code_scanning %} alert dismissal requests
3+
shortTitle: Alert dismissal requests
4+
intro: Use the REST API to interact with {% data variables.product.prodname_code_scanning %} alert dismissal requests from a repository.
5+
versions: # DO NOT MANUALLY EDIT. CHANGES WILL BE OVERWRITTEN BY A 🤖
6+
ghec: '*'
7+
topics:
8+
- API
9+
autogenerated: rest
10+
allowTitleToDifferFromFilename: true
11+
---
12+
13+
<!-- Content after this section is automatically generated -->

content/rest/code-scanning/index.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,7 @@ topics:
1414
- Code scanning
1515
- REST
1616
children:
17+
- /alert-dismissal-requests
1718
- /code-scanning
1819
autogenerated: rest
1920
---

src/github-apps/data/fpt-2022-11-28/fine-grained-pat-permissions.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8288,4 +8288,4 @@
82888288
}
82898289
]
82908290
}
8291-
}
8291+
}

src/github-apps/data/ghec-2022-11-28/fine-grained-pat-permissions.json

Lines changed: 72 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
"enterprise_custom_properties": {
33
"title": "Custom properties",
4-
"displayTitle": "Business permissions for \"Custom properties\"",
4+
"displayTitle": "Enterprise permissions for \"Custom properties\"",
55
"permissions": [
66
{
77
"category": "enterprise-admin",
@@ -61,7 +61,7 @@
6161
},
6262
"enterprise_scim": {
6363
"title": "Enterprise SCIM",
64-
"displayTitle": "Business permissions for \"Enterprise SCIM\"",
64+
"displayTitle": "Enterprise permissions for \"Enterprise SCIM\"",
6565
"permissions": [
6666
{
6767
"category": "enterprise-admin",
@@ -2264,6 +2264,48 @@
22642264
}
22652265
]
22662266
},
2267+
"organization_code_scanning_dismissal_requests": {
2268+
"title": "Organization dismissal requests for code scanning",
2269+
"displayTitle": "Organization permissions for \"Organization dismissal requests for code scanning\"",
2270+
"permissions": [
2271+
{
2272+
"category": "code-scanning",
2273+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-an-organization",
2274+
"subcategory": "alert-dismissal-requests",
2275+
"verb": "get",
2276+
"requestPath": "/orgs/{org}/dismissal-requests/code-scanning",
2277+
"additional-permissions": false,
2278+
"access": "read"
2279+
},
2280+
{
2281+
"category": "code-scanning",
2282+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
2283+
"subcategory": "alert-dismissal-requests",
2284+
"verb": "get",
2285+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ning",
2286+
"additional-permissions": true,
2287+
"access": "read"
2288+
},
2289+
{
2290+
"category": "code-scanning",
2291+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
2292+
"subcategory": "alert-dismissal-requests",
2293+
"verb": "get",
2294+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
2295+
"additional-permissions": true,
2296+
"access": "read"
2297+
},
2298+
{
2299+
"category": "code-scanning",
2300+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
2301+
"subcategory": "alert-dismissal-requests",
2302+
"verb": "patch",
2303+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
2304+
"additional-permissions": true,
2305+
"access": "write"
2306+
}
2307+
]
2308+
},
22672309
"organization_private_registries": {
22682310
"title": "Organization private registries",
22692311
"displayTitle": "Organization permissions for \"Organization private registries\"",
@@ -4961,6 +5003,33 @@
49615003
"requestPath": "/repos/{owner}/{repo}/code-scanning/sarifs/{sarif_id}",
49625004
"additional-permissions": false,
49635005
"access": "read"
5006+
},
5007+
{
5008+
"category": "code-scanning",
5009+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
5010+
"subcategory": "alert-dismissal-requests",
5011+
"verb": "get",
5012+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ning",
5013+
"additional-permissions": true,
5014+
"access": "read"
5015+
},
5016+
{
5017+
"category": "code-scanning",
5018+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
5019+
"subcategory": "alert-dismissal-requests",
5020+
"verb": "get",
5021+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
5022+
"additional-permissions": true,
5023+
"access": "read"
5024+
},
5025+
{
5026+
"category": "code-scanning",
5027+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
5028+
"subcategory": "alert-dismissal-requests",
5029+
"verb": "patch",
5030+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
5031+
"additional-permissions": true,
5032+
"access": "read"
49645033
}
49655034
]
49665035
},
@@ -9002,4 +9071,4 @@
90029071
}
90039072
]
90049073
}
9005-
}
9074+
}

src/github-apps/data/ghec-2022-11-28/fine-grained-pat.json

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1512,6 +1512,12 @@
15121512
"verb": "get",
15131513
"requestPath": "/orgs/{org}/code-scanning/alerts"
15141514
},
1515+
{
1516+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-an-organization",
1517+
"subcategory": "alert-dismissal-requests",
1518+
"verb": "get",
1519+
"requestPath": "/orgs/{org}/dismissal-requests/code-scanning"
1520+
},
15151521
{
15161522
"slug": "list-code-scanning-alerts-for-a-repository",
15171523
"subcategory": "code-scanning",
@@ -1631,6 +1637,24 @@
16311637
"subcategory": "code-scanning",
16321638
"verb": "get",
16331639
"requestPath": "/repos/{owner}/{repo}/code-scanning/sarifs/{sarif_id}"
1640+
},
1641+
{
1642+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
1643+
"subcategory": "alert-dismissal-requests",
1644+
"verb": "get",
1645+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ning"
1646+
},
1647+
{
1648+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1649+
"subcategory": "alert-dismissal-requests",
1650+
"verb": "get",
1651+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
1652+
},
1653+
{
1654+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1655+
"subcategory": "alert-dismissal-requests",
1656+
"verb": "patch",
1657+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
16341658
}
16351659
],
16361660
"code-security": [

src/github-apps/data/ghec-2022-11-28/server-to-server-permissions.json

Lines changed: 85 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
"enterprise_custom_properties": {
33
"title": "Custom properties",
4-
"displayTitle": "Business permissions for \"Custom properties\"",
4+
"displayTitle": "Enterprise permissions for \"Custom properties\"",
55
"permissions": [
66
{
77
"category": "enterprise-admin",
@@ -73,7 +73,7 @@
7373
},
7474
"enterprise_scim": {
7575
"title": "Enterprise SCIM",
76-
"displayTitle": "Business permissions for \"Enterprise SCIM\"",
76+
"displayTitle": "Enterprise permissions for \"Enterprise SCIM\"",
7777
"permissions": [
7878
{
7979
"category": "enterprise-admin",
@@ -2742,6 +2742,56 @@
27422742
}
27432743
]
27442744
},
2745+
"organization_code_scanning_dismissal_requests": {
2746+
"title": "Organization dismissal requests for code scanning",
2747+
"displayTitle": "Organization permissions for \"Organization dismissal requests for code scanning\"",
2748+
"permissions": [
2749+
{
2750+
"category": "code-scanning",
2751+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-an-organization",
2752+
"subcategory": "alert-dismissal-requests",
2753+
"verb": "get",
2754+
"requestPath": "/orgs/{org}/dismissal-requests/code-scanning",
2755+
"access": "read",
2756+
"user-to-server": true,
2757+
"server-to-server": true,
2758+
"additional-permissions": false
2759+
},
2760+
{
2761+
"category": "code-scanning",
2762+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
2763+
"subcategory": "alert-dismissal-requests",
2764+
"verb": "get",
2765+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ning",
2766+
"access": "read",
2767+
"user-to-server": true,
2768+
"server-to-server": true,
2769+
"additional-permissions": true
2770+
},
2771+
{
2772+
"category": "code-scanning",
2773+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
2774+
"subcategory": "alert-dismissal-requests",
2775+
"verb": "get",
2776+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
2777+
"access": "read",
2778+
"user-to-server": true,
2779+
"server-to-server": true,
2780+
"additional-permissions": true
2781+
},
2782+
{
2783+
"category": "code-scanning",
2784+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
2785+
"subcategory": "alert-dismissal-requests",
2786+
"verb": "patch",
2787+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
2788+
"access": "write",
2789+
"user-to-server": true,
2790+
"server-to-server": true,
2791+
"additional-permissions": true
2792+
}
2793+
]
2794+
},
27452795
"organization_private_registries": {
27462796
"title": "Organization private registries",
27472797
"displayTitle": "Organization permissions for \"Organization private registries\"",
@@ -6019,6 +6069,39 @@
60196069
"user-to-server": true,
60206070
"server-to-server": true,
60216071
"additional-permissions": false
6072+
},
6073+
{
6074+
"category": "code-scanning",
6075+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
6076+
"subcategory": "alert-dismissal-requests",
6077+
"verb": "get",
6078+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ning",
6079+
"access": "read",
6080+
"user-to-server": true,
6081+
"server-to-server": true,
6082+
"additional-permissions": true
6083+
},
6084+
{
6085+
"category": "code-scanning",
6086+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
6087+
"subcategory": "alert-dismissal-requests",
6088+
"verb": "get",
6089+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
6090+
"access": "read",
6091+
"user-to-server": true,
6092+
"server-to-server": true,
6093+
"additional-permissions": true
6094+
},
6095+
{
6096+
"category": "code-scanning",
6097+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
6098+
"subcategory": "alert-dismissal-requests",
6099+
"verb": "patch",
6100+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}",
6101+
"access": "read",
6102+
"user-to-server": true,
6103+
"server-to-server": true,
6104+
"additional-permissions": true
60226105
}
60236106
]
60246107
},

src/github-apps/data/ghec-2022-11-28/server-to-server-rest.json

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1408,6 +1408,12 @@
14081408
"verb": "get",
14091409
"requestPath": "/orgs/{org}/code-scanning/alerts"
14101410
},
1411+
{
1412+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-an-organization",
1413+
"subcategory": "alert-dismissal-requests",
1414+
"verb": "get",
1415+
"requestPath": "/orgs/{org}/dismissal-requests/code-scanning"
1416+
},
14111417
{
14121418
"slug": "list-code-scanning-alerts-for-a-repository",
14131419
"subcategory": "code-scanning",
@@ -1527,6 +1533,24 @@
15271533
"subcategory": "code-scanning",
15281534
"verb": "get",
15291535
"requestPath": "/repos/{owner}/{repo}/code-scanning/sarifs/{sarif_id}"
1536+
},
1537+
{
1538+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
1539+
"subcategory": "alert-dismissal-requests",
1540+
"verb": "get",
1541+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ning"
1542+
},
1543+
{
1544+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1545+
"subcategory": "alert-dismissal-requests",
1546+
"verb": "get",
1547+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
1548+
},
1549+
{
1550+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1551+
"subcategory": "alert-dismissal-requests",
1552+
"verb": "patch",
1553+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
15301554
}
15311555
],
15321556
"code-security": [

src/github-apps/data/ghec-2022-11-28/user-to-server-rest.json

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1512,6 +1512,12 @@
15121512
"verb": "get",
15131513
"requestPath": "/orgs/{org}/code-scanning/alerts"
15141514
},
1515+
{
1516+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-an-organization",
1517+
"subcategory": "alert-dismissal-requests",
1518+
"verb": "get",
1519+
"requestPath": "/orgs/{org}/dismissal-requests/code-scanning"
1520+
},
15151521
{
15161522
"slug": "list-code-scanning-alerts-for-a-repository",
15171523
"subcategory": "code-scanning",
@@ -1631,6 +1637,24 @@
16311637
"subcategory": "code-scanning",
16321638
"verb": "get",
16331639
"requestPath": "/repos/{owner}/{repo}/code-scanning/sarifs/{sarif_id}"
1640+
},
1641+
{
1642+
"slug": "list-dismissal-requests-for-code-scanning-alerts-for-a-repository",
1643+
"subcategory": "alert-dismissal-requests",
1644+
"verb": "get",
1645+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ning"
1646+
},
1647+
{
1648+
"slug": "get-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1649+
"subcategory": "alert-dismissal-requests",
1650+
"verb": "get",
1651+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
1652+
},
1653+
{
1654+
"slug": "review-a-dismissal-request-for-a-code-scanning-alert-for-a-repository",
1655+
"subcategory": "alert-dismissal-requests",
1656+
"verb": "patch",
1657+
"requestPath": "/repos/{owner}/{repo}/dismissal-requests/code-scanning/{alert_number}"
16341658
}
16351659
],
16361660
"code-security": [

src/github-apps/data/ghes-3.13-2022-11-28/fine-grained-pat-permissions.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
"enterprise_scim": {
33
"title": "Enterprise SCIM",
4-
"displayTitle": "Business permissions for \"Enterprise SCIM\"",
4+
"displayTitle": "Enterprise permissions for \"Enterprise SCIM\"",
55
"permissions": [
66
{
77
"category": "enterprise-admin",
@@ -6527,4 +6527,4 @@
65276527
}
65286528
]
65296529
}
6530-
}
6530+
}

src/github-apps/data/ghes-3.13-2022-11-28/server-to-server-permissions.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
"enterprise_scim": {
33
"title": "Enterprise SCIM",
4-
"displayTitle": "Business permissions for \"Enterprise SCIM\"",
4+
"displayTitle": "Enterprise permissions for \"Enterprise SCIM\"",
55
"permissions": [
66
{
77
"category": "enterprise-admin",

0 commit comments

Comments
 (0)